Sourcing guidance for Led Decoration Light

How to choose the right LED decoration lights for commercial or residential projects?

Selecting high-quality LED decoration lights requires a focus on durability, safety certifications, and lighting performance. For commercial projects, prioritize commercial-grade LEDs with a high Color Rendering Index (CRI >80) to ensure colors appear vibrant and true. For residential use, focus on versatility and ease of installation. Always verify the IP Rating (e.g., IP44 for indoors, IP65+ for outdoors) to ensure the product can withstand environmental moisture or dust. Additionally, look for flicker-free drivers to prevent eye strain and ensure compatibility with smart home dimming systems if required.

What are the essential compliance standards and certifications for LED lights?

Compliance is non-negotiable in cross-border trade to avoid customs seizures or legal liabilities. Ensure products carry CE, RoHS, and REACH certifications for the European market, or UL/ETL and FCC for North America. For the Australian market, SAA certification is mandatory. Specifically for decoration lights, check for fire-retardant cable materials (V-0 rating) and low-voltage transformers (12V/24V) to enhance user safety and reduce fire risks.

How can I evaluate the technical quality and lifespan of LED decoration lights?

The lifespan of an LED is determined by its heat dissipation and chip quality. Request documentation on the LED chip brand (e.g., Epistar, Cree, or San'an) and the L70 lifespan rating, which should ideally be above 30,000 to 50,000 hours. Examine the wire gauge (AWG); thicker copper wires prevent voltage drops in long strings. For outdoor motifs or neon flex, ensure the UV-resistant PVC or Silicone coating is used to prevent yellowing and cracking over time.

What customization options should I look for when sourcing from suppliers?

Professional suppliers on Made-in-China.com should offer OEM/ODM services, including customizable lengths, bulb spacing, and color temperatures (CCT). For branding, inquire about custom packaging and logo printing on controllers or transformers. Advanced buyers should seek suppliers capable of providing programmable IC chips (like WS2812B) for addressable RGB effects, which are highly sought after in modern event decoration.

Cross-Border Purchasing Considerations for LED Lighting

What are the common risks when importing LED decoration lights?

The primary risks include voltage incompatibility and poor waterproof sealing. Always confirm the input voltage (110V vs 220V) and plug type match the destination country. Another risk is lumen depreciation; some low-cost suppliers use inferior phosphor, causing lights to dim significantly after just 1,000 hours. To mitigate this, request a sample and conduct a 48-hour burn-in test before placing a bulk order.

How should I negotiate with suppliers for bulk LED orders?

Focus on the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Negotiate for spare parts (1-2% extra bulbs or controllers) to be included in the shipment to handle potential DOA (Dead on Arrival) units. For large volumes, request a tiered pricing structure where the price drops by 5-10% as quantities reach container levels. What are the best practices for shipping and logistics for fragile lighting products?

LED decoration lights, especially those with glass bulbs or large acrylic motifs, are fragile. Insist on 5-layer corrugated export cartons and internal foam padding. For sea freight, ensure the use of desiccant silica gel packs inside the packaging to prevent moisture buildup and oxidation of metal contacts during the long voyage. For urgent seasonal stock (like Christmas), consider Air Freight for high-value items, but calculate the volumetric weight carefully as lighting is often bulky.
